Dr. Ally La Barbara is a pediatrician at UCSF Primary Care at Laurel Village. She is particularly interested in providing integrative care and urgent care to children of all ages. Her interests also include working with parents to construct detailed treatment plans for their children to address nutrition, behavior, and health optimization, incorporating homeopathy and functional medicine.
La Barbara is a graduate of the UCSF School of Medicine. She completed a residency in pediatrics at Lucile Packard Children's Hospital at Stanford. She is an assistant clinical professor in pediatrics at UCSF and a member of the American Academy of Pediatrics. She is learning French at the Alliance Francaise de San Francisco, and understands academic Italian and medical Spanish.
